FLUORESCENCE STUDIES OF THE COIL TO GLOBULE TRANSITION OF ACENAPHTHYLENE LABELED POLY(N,N-DIETHYLACRYLAMIDE) IN DILUTE AQUEOUS UREA SOLUTION
In general, the coil to globule transition (CGT) would occur in a very small temperature interval for long stiff polymer chains but span over a broad temperature interval for short flexible chains.1 However, there is a lack of quantitative information regarding the changes of the mobility of the chain occurring in the CGT.2 Fluorescence techniques, including quenching and anisotropy measurements, 3,4 have been used to study the effects of urea on the conformational behavior of acenaphthylene labeled poly (N, N-diethylacrylamide) (PDEA/ACE) in dilute aqueous solution.
